Update wording in optimizer/README for EquivalenceClasses
d69d45a changed how em_is_child members are stored in EquivalenceClasses. Children are no longer stored in the ec_members list. optimizer/README mentioned that most operations "should ignore child members", but that felt a little untrue now since child members are now stored in a separate place, they simply won't be found by the normal means of looking (a foreach loop over ec_members), and if you don't find them, there's technically no need to "ignore" them. Here we tweak the wording slightly to reflect the new storage location for child members.
